Open the documentsWhat a grant of permission means
The process from here
Permission has been granted, usually subject to conditions listed on the decision notice, some of which must be discharged before work starts. The decision notice on the council portal sets out exactly what was approved.
Work must normally begin within three years of the decision or the permission lapses. Neighbours cannot appeal a grant; challenging one means judicial review of how the decision was made, within tight time limits.
About householder applications
How this application type works
Householder applications cover work to an existing house and its garden: extensions, loft and garage conversions, porches, outbuildings and similar alterations within the boundary of the home. They cannot be used to create a separate dwelling or change what the building is used for. Councils aim to decide them within eight weeks, and immediate neighbours are usually notified and given a chance to comment.
